Moreno de Alboran Reaches Second Round of NCAA Singles Tourney

Nicolas Moreno de Alboran advanced to the second round of the men's singles NCAA tennis tournament with a first-round victory, the first Gaucho to win a singles match in the tournament since 1995.

Gauchos Finish Off Perfect Home Season, Sweep UC Riverside On The Road

On Friday, UCSB swept UC Davis 7-0 to finish 11-0 at home and on Sunday, the 'Chos swept UCR to remain perfect in conference play at 4-0.
